Kim Hanson, CEO of LearningRx

Kim Hanson, CEO

Kim Hanson is the Chief Executive Officer of LearningRx. She began her leadership role with the organization in 2004 as Executive Vice President and was named CEO in 2017. Her career passion is to help professionals, educators, and parents learn more about cognitive skills training and the dramatic results it can have on real-life performance.

Prior to her time with LearningRx, Ms. Hanson worked in education with second and fifth graders at several inner-city schools in Nashville and Minneapolis. She is Certified Franchise Executive (CFE) and is a graduate of North Central University in Minneapolis. Ms. Hanson is the proud daughter of Dr. Ken Gibson, founder of LearningRx, with whom she co-authored the book Unlock the Einstein Inside: Applying New Brain Science to Wake Up the Smart in Your Child.

Beyond the workplace, she currently enjoys mentoring high school and college students as they identify future career options. In addition, she is a vocal advocate for the civil rights of people with intellectual and developmental disabilities (I/DD). Dean Tenpas, COO

Dean Tenpas is the Chief Operating Officer at LearningRx. Mr. Tenpas oversees finance, human resources, technology, and the operations departments. Prior to his current role, Mr. Tenpas served as Executive Vice President. With a master’s degree in counseling from the University of Wisconsin, Mr. Tenpas also co-created many of the company’s cognitive training exercises and programs, as well as the ReadRx® reading program and assessments used by clinicians and brain training centers in the United States and around the world.

Dr. Amy Lawson Moore, Director of Psychology & Research

Dr. Amy Moore is a cognitive psychologist and the Director of Psychology and Research at LearningRx in Colorado Springs, CO at the headquarters of the largest network of cognitive training centers in the world. She specializes in neuroplasticity-based interventions for neurodevelopmental disorders like ADHD, learning disabilities, concussions & TBI, and age-related cognitive decline. Her brain training research has been published in peer-reviewed medical and psychology journals and presented at conferences around the country. Dr. Amy leads a team of two cognitive psychologists, a clinical neuroscientist, and a psychology research associate who oversee research, assessment, and strategic challenge-solving.

Dr. Amy has been a child development specialist, parent educator, and teacher of teachers with a PhD in psychology and a master’s degree in early childhood education. She’s been working with struggling learners for 30 years. She is a TEDx speaker, host of the Brainy Moms podcast, a board-certified Christian counselor, trauma specialist, life coach, writer, an ADHD mom, and a mom with ADHD. Dr. Jody Jedlicka, Director of Support

As Director of Support, Dr. Jody Jedlicka oversees the support of brain training programs and business processes for all LearningRx Centers. Jody and her husband, an educational psychologist, have operated 3 LearningRx centers in Wisconsin (2) and Hawaii and know firsthand the day-to-day life of a franchisee/director.

Jody is an audiologist who specializes in the diagnosis and treatment of children with auditory processing disorders. It was her search for effective treatment options for her patients that led her to LearningRx in 2004. She is also a certified success coach and trainer.

Carrie Downs, Director of Marketing

Carrie Downs joined the LearningRx leadership team in 2023 as the Director of Marketing. Carrie has over 15 years experience in market research, campaign development, and analytics for businesses and franchise systems of all sizes.

Carrie assists the LearningRx centers across the United States and Canada in optimizing their marketing campaigns, ensuring brand consistency, and maximizing the brand’s visibility.

Natalie Speakman, Director of Development

Natalie Speakman is the Director of Development at LearningRx and oversees the marketing and sales of the company’s new brain training franchises and licenses. Natalie began her career at LearningRx in 2010 where she assumed two business-building roles. First, as Center Director for the corporate-owned LearningRx franchise in Colorado Springs, Colorado and then, as a Business Coach supporting the company’s entire network of franchise owners.

With 15+ years’ experience in the brain training industry, along with a master’s degree in Business Administration from the University of Colorado, Colorado Springs, Natalie has made significant (and lasting) contributions to LearningRx’s systems, training processes, marketing efforts, and franchisee support programs.
